黑狐家游戏

简述数据库恢复的基本原理,简述数据库恢复的几种方法简答题,数据库恢复方法的概述及原理分析

欧气 1 0
数据库恢复基本原理是通过记录数据库的变更,确保在发生故障时能够恢复至一致状态。主要方法包括:备份与恢复、日志恢复、点时间恢复、增量恢复等。备份与恢复通过定期备份整个数据库或其部分,故障发生时恢复至备份点;日志恢复利用事务日志回滚未完成事务;点时间恢复通过指定时间点前后的数据状态恢复;增量恢复仅恢复自上次备份或恢复以来发生的变化。这些方法各有优缺点,需根据实际情况选择。

本文目录导读:

  1. 数据库恢复的基本原理
  2. 数据库恢复方法

数据库作为现代信息社会中不可或缺的基础设施,其稳定性和可靠性至关重要,在运行过程中,数据库可能会因为各种原因出现故障,导致数据丢失或损坏,为了确保数据库的安全性和可靠性,数据库恢复技术应运而生,本文将简述数据库恢复的基本原理,并介绍几种常见的数据库恢复方法。

简述数据库恢复的基本原理,简述数据库恢复的几种方法简答题,数据库恢复方法的概述及原理分析

图片来源于网络,如有侵权联系删除

数据库恢复的基本原理

数据库恢复是指当数据库出现故障时,将数据库恢复到一致状态的过程,数据库恢复的基本原理如下:

1、数据冗余:在数据库中,通过冗余数据(如备份、镜像等)来保证数据的安全性,当数据库出现故障时,可以从冗余数据中恢复数据。

2、事务日志:事务日志记录了数据库中所有事务的详细信息,包括事务的起始、结束以及事务对数据库的修改操作,通过事务日志,可以恢复数据库到某个时刻的一致状态。

3、恢复策略:根据数据库恢复的需求,可以选择不同的恢复策略,如前滚恢复、后滚恢复等。

数据库恢复方法

1、完全备份恢复

完全备份恢复是最常见的数据库恢复方法之一,该方法在数据库正常工作时,定期对整个数据库进行备份,当数据库出现故障时,可以从备份中恢复整个数据库。

优点:简单易行,恢复速度快。

缺点:备份数据量大,需要占用大量存储空间。

2、差分备份恢复

差分备份恢复是在完全备份的基础上,对数据库进行增量备份,该方法只备份自上次完全备份以来发生变化的数据库数据。

优点:备份数据量小,存储空间占用较少。

简述数据库恢复的基本原理,简述数据库恢复的几种方法简答题,数据库恢复方法的概述及原理分析

图片来源于网络,如有侵权联系删除

缺点:恢复过程中需要依次恢复完全备份和差分备份,恢复速度较慢。

3、增量备份恢复

增量备份恢复是对数据库进行逐日备份,只记录自上次备份以来发生变化的数据库数据。

优点:备份数据量小,存储空间占用较少。

缺点:恢复过程中需要依次恢复所有增量备份,恢复速度较慢。

4、事务日志恢复

事务日志恢复是利用事务日志恢复数据库到某个特定时刻的一致状态,该方法分为以下步骤:

(1)将数据库恢复到故障发生前的某个时刻;

(2)利用事务日志,对数据库进行前滚恢复,即将事务日志中的修改操作应用到数据库中。

优点:可以恢复到特定时刻的一致状态,恢复速度快。

缺点:需要占用大量存储空间,事务日志恢复过程中可能会出现性能问题。

简述数据库恢复的基本原理,简述数据库恢复的几种方法简答题,数据库恢复方法的概述及原理分析

图片来源于网络,如有侵权联系删除

5、快照恢复

快照恢复是利用数据库快照技术,将数据库恢复到某个特定时刻的状态,该方法分为以下步骤:

(1)创建数据库快照;

(2)将数据库恢复到快照时刻;

(3)将快照中的数据应用到实际数据库中。

优点:恢复速度快,可以恢复到特定时刻的一致状态。

缺点:需要依赖数据库快照技术,可能对数据库性能产生影响。

数据库恢复是保障数据库安全性和可靠性的重要手段,本文介绍了数据库恢复的基本原理和几种常见的数据库恢复方法,包括完全备份恢复、差分备份恢复、增量备份恢复、事务日志恢复和快照恢复,在实际应用中,应根据数据库的具体需求和特点,选择合适的数据库恢复方法,确保数据库的安全稳定运行。

黑狐家游戏
  • 评论列表

留言评论